— At least 2 years of practical experience with .NET framework;
— Solid understanding of object-oriented design and concepts;
— Experience with .NET Core, ASP.NET Core/ ASP.NET Web API 2;
— Experience with AngularJS, Angular, HTML, CSS;
— Practical experience with SQL and MSSQL
— Intermediate level of English;
— Ability to work independently without constant supervision;
— Ability to come up with several solutions to some technical problem;
— Ability to differentiate between root cause and consequence in some problem.
— Experience with Unit Testing (.Net/JS);
— Possess knowledge of Entity Framework;
— Experience in working with Agile Methodology (for example SCRUM);
— Experience in building distributed systems and Software as a Service (SaaS);
— Friendly team and enjoyable working environment.
— Opportunity for self-realization. Career and professional growth.
— Competitive compensation based on your qualifications, experience, and skills
— Paid sick leave and vacations
— English classes with a certified English teacher.
— Office in a comfortable business center, located near a subway station.
— Official journeys abroad with expenses reimbursement.
— Flexible working hours
— Company-owned gym and shower
— Convenient parking near the office building
— Room for bicycle parking
— Corporate events and meetings
— Large recreation area
— Not an open space office (We work remotely for some time in 2020)
— Participate in new features architecture & design
— Implement new features as a full-stack engineer (FE+BE)
— Tricky problems/bugs investigation & fixes from production
— Getting rid of technical debt (refactoring yeah)
— Evaluation of new technologies
— Response to production incidents & work together with other teams to troubleshoot them